
Bulldogs starts postseason Wednesday
PERKINSTON — Mississippi Gulf Coast heads into the always tough MACCC Tournament as an underdog.
The Bulldogs claimed the final berth in the eight-team bracket on the final day of the season on Friday. They swept Mississippi Delta on the road and got some help.
Gulf Coast opens its tournament Wednesday in Ellisville by playing No. 4 Jones, which finished atop the regular-season standings. "Jones is very, very good," Gulf Coast coach David Kuhn said. "They're a great team with a great coaching staff. It's an awesome challenge for us. They're very good and have dominated all year long, but we played very well against them and had opportunities. We're excited to live for another day."
The event includes four other teams in the NJCAA Division II Top 20: No. 5 Copiah-Lincoln, No. 6 Itawamba, No. 9 Pearl River and No. 13 Northwest Mississippi.
Five teams will advance from the tournament to NJCAA Region 23 Tournament next week. For Gulf Coast, that means the Bulldogs have to win twice in any combination of winners' or losers' brackets games.
If they stay on the top of the bracket and keep winning games, it would mean only playing one game a day.
"It gives you a chance where you can use your entire pitching staff," Kuhn said. "You don't have to hold anything back to save an arm for next game. I like it. I look forward to it a lot."
